Memphis, Tulane, South Florida, and Texas-San Antonio announced Monday that they remain committed to the American Athletic Conference after receiving overtures from the Pac-12.
Memphis, Tulane, South Florida, UTSA reaffirm commitment to AAC after Pac-12 talks
The schools had seen presentations from the Pac-12 but ultimately felt the league’s uncertainty and travel weren’t enough to leave.

Hughes, special teams help Tulane hold off Ragin’ Cajuns 41-33
Makhi Hughes led a solid Tulane ground game with a 166 yards and a touchdown and the Green Wave rode a pair of special teams touchdowns to a 41-33 win over Louisiana Lafayette on Saturday.
